The document explains communication protocols, defining them as rules for data exchange between electronic devices. It distinguishes between inter system protocols, like UART, USART, USB, and intra system protocols, such as I2C, SPI, and CAN, each serving different communication needs. Key features and examples of each protocol are outlined, emphasizing aspects like data transmission methods and requirements.